#eeccf2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eeccf2 is composed of 93.3% red, 80%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.7% cyan, 15.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 293.7 degrees, a saturation of 59.4% and a lightness of 87.5%. #eeccf2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#dd99e5. Closest websafe color is: #ffccff.

● #eeccf2 color description : Light grayish magenta.
#eeccf2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eeccf2 has RGB values of R:238, G:204,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0.16,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15650034.
